What Are HS Codes for Optical Inspection Parts?
HS codes provide a universal system to classify goods like optical inspection parts for global trade.
- Developed by the World Customs Organization (WCO)
- 6-digit standard, extended nationally to 8-10 digits
- Essential for determining duties, taxes, and trade statistics
- Updated periodically; focus on 2025 national adaptations
- Chapter 90 covers optical, photographic, and measuring tools
Optical inspection parts, used in quality control and semiconductors, demand precise coding to avoid delays.
Primary HS Codes for Optical Inspection Parts in 2025
Key HS codes for optical inspection parts include stable entries with minor 2025 refinements.
| HS Code | Description | Applications | 2025 Status |
| 9002.11 | Lenses for cameras or projectors | Objective lens modules | Unchanged globally |
| 9002.19 | Other mounted optical elements | Inspection lenses | EU Combined Nomenclature tweak |
| 9002.90 | Optical elements, unmounted | Precision optics parts | Stable |
| 9031.41 | Optical instruments for inspecting semiconductors | Wafer and chip scanners | US HTS enforcement ramps up |
| 9031.49 | Other optical inspection instruments | General quality control | GCC extends to 12 digits |

How to Find the Correct HS Code for Optical Inspection Parts
Use this step-by-step guide to determine the right HS code for optical inspection parts in 2025.
- Define the principal function: Pure optics (9002) or inspection tool (9031)?
- Select Chapter 90 subheading: Lenses (9002.xx) vs. instruments (9031.xx)
- Evaluate mounting: Mounted elements (9002.1x) or other (9002.90)
- Incorporate regional extensions: Add HTS digits for US, 12-digit for GCC
- Validate officially: Consult WCO database or request binding rulings
- Test with samples: Ship small volumes to confirm clearance
